Summary
On May 08, 2012, a Agusta AW119MKII (PP-CGO) was involved in an accident near Piranhas, BR. The accident resulted in 8 fatal injuries. The aircraft was destroyed.
On May 8, 2012, about 0947 universal coordinated time, an Augusta Westland AW119 MKII helicopter, Brazilian registration PP-CGO, was destroyed when it impacted trees and terrain during a forced landing following a loss of engine power in Piranhas, Goias, Brazil. The Brazilian certificated pilots and 6 passengers were fatally injured. The flight departed Santa Genoveva International Airport (SBGO), Goiania, Brazil; destined for a refueling point in Piranhas, Brazil. The helicopter was participating in a crime reconstruction exercise.
This accident investigation is under the jurisdiction of the Aeronautical Accident Prevention and Investigation Center (CENIPA) of Brazil.
